Abstract
The heptameric Arp2/3 complex generates branched actin filament networks that drive lamellipodium protrusion, vesicle trafficking and pathogen motility. Distinct variants of the Arp2/3 complex are now shown to have different roles in tuning actin assembly and disassembly, in concert with the prominent actin regulators cortactin and coronin.
